Ha Giang - Dong Van
Quan Ba Heaven Gate - As you depart from the city, the first major highlight of the Ha Giang loop is Quan Ba Pass. Reaching the top of the pass, you’ll find a small café, an ideal spot for a drink and a restroom break. However, the main reason to pause here is the breathtaking view of the Ha Giang mountains, offering a glimpse of the stunning landscapes that await you in the days ahead.
Afterward, descend the mountain pass to Quan Ba town, making a stop halfway at a parking area. It’s easy to miss, as there’s nothing immediately noticeable, but from here, you can climb the stairs to a viewpoint that offers a picturesque view of the Twin Mountains, also known as the Fairy Breast mountains.
Yen Minh - The journey from Yen Minh to Sa Phin takes you over the Tham Ma Pass, one of the impressive mountain passes in the UNESCO Dong Van Karst Plateau Geopark. A winding road leads to a small parking area where you can capture photos of this scenic pass.
Dinh Vua Meo - The Hmong King’s Palace in Sa Phin is built in a Chinese architectural style, primarily using wood, stone, and terracotta tiles. It is one of the oldest structures in the region, originally constructed to protect the Vuong family from attacks. The family amassed wealth through trade, particularly in opium.
Dong Van - Dong Van is a principal town in Ha Giang, often chosen by travelers for an overnight stay during their Ha Giang loop. The historical section, known as Dong Van Old Quarter, features preserved architecture dating back centuries. At night, it offers a cozy atmosphere perfect for enjoying the surroundings. Behind the Old Quarter, an old French Fort atop a mountain provides views over the city and surrounding mountains.
Dong Van - Du Gia
Nho Que River - The Nho Que River is part of the stunning scenery from the Ma Pi Leng Pass. There are also hidden roads that lead down to the river, where you can embark on a one-hour boat trip between the towering cliffs of the pass.
Meo Vac - If you happen to be in Meo Vac on a Sunday, you’re in for a treat. The Meo Vac market is the largest minority market in Ha Giang and one of the most remarkable markets in Vietnam. It starts very early in the morning and begins to quiet down around 11:00 AM. The market includes a livestock section where people bring their animals not only to sell but also to showcase. The streets are lined with stalls selling everything from local products to cell phones. The indoor market serves as a large food market, offering fresh food and small stalls where meals are prepared over an open fire.
Du Gia - Ha Giang
Lung Ho - Lung Ho in Ha Giang is a captivating destination for tourists, especially young adventurers eager to explore and conquer new terrains. This commune in Yen Minh district spans about 54 km2 and is divided into 23 villages.
Quan Ba - Lung Tam is renowned as a traditional craft village specializing in brocade weaving by the Hmong people on the Dong Van plateau in Ha Giang province. In addition to brocade products that are popular among both domestic and international visitors, the unique weaving process in Lung Tam village is a notable attraction for visitors to Quan Ba district.
